EDUC 662 - DEVELOPING HIGHER LEVEL THINKING/READING SKILLS IN ADULTS

Institution:
Delaware State University
Subject:
Education
Description:
The course will cover such areas as analyzing written materials to determine what higher order thinking/reading skills would be required to complete a task. The thinking/reading skills tested on the GED will receive special emphasis. Strategies for teaching and reinforcing these skills will be presented.Credit, three hours.
